This outfit is inspired by Karliah from the Thieves Guild in the Elder Scrolls V: Skyrim. I wanted to incorporate the multiple textures of her in-game Nightingale armor, as well as the woodsy feeling of her character. I chose black leather-looking pants paired with a longer sheer black tunic. I also chose knee high black leather boots. I wanted to feature some fall trends so I chose a black cape jacket and a dark brown floppy wool hat. The cape reminded me something a member of the Thieves Guild would wear to hide in the darkness. I also found a beautiful clutch, decorated with woodsy imagery. Lastly, I chose bird earrings representing the Nightingale and an arrow bracelet because that’s her weapon on choice. (Reference Image)
This outfit is inspired by the glass armour set of Elder Scrolls V: Skyrim. I chose this armor because I think it’s absolutely beautiful in the game and thought it would translate well into an evening look. I chose a metallic gold wrap dress that imitates the armour’s texture, paired with light green accessories. I chose jewelry that had a very glass-y look to them, further replicating the armor. This outfit is inspired by Alduin of Elder Scrolls V: Skyrim. I chose a black cocktail dress with tons of textures that imitate his scale-y exterior. I also chose dark grey accessories that compliment the dress’s texture. Lastly, I chose silver hoop earrings with a tooth on each which reminds me of dragon’s teeth. (Reference Image)
